4.    Shiny Balls – Navigate life's distractions with precision—categorize shiny balls, dismiss the unnecessary, acknowledge the secondary, and promptly handle the critical. Stay unwavering on your journey to long-term success amidst life's alluring disruptions.


Life is full of shiny distractions—enticing, captivating, but potentially derailing. Whether you're on a task, working on daily objectives, or pursuing larger goals, staying focused is key. Shiny balls are the difference between winning and losing teams. The energy lost to distractions, even for a moment, can have a significant impact.

To manage shiny balls effectively, categorize them:

1. Absolute Distraction: Dismiss immediately. Go faster.

2. Secondary Distraction: Acknowledge but stay on the main objective. Divert the least amount of resources and address it swiftly.

3. Critical Distraction: Deal with it promptly. Maintain momentum on the main objective while resolving the issue.


By classifying distractions and managing them unemotionally, you can stay focused on your long-term goals and navigate through life's beautiful but potentially disruptive moments.
